W. T. Carter and Brother Lumber Company derelict locomotives near the engine shop in Camden, Texas. Depicted is engine 3, a Shay locomotive, engine 5, a 4-6-0, and engine 1, a 2-6-0. The lumber company kept old engines for parts. Taken on April 26, 1959. This photograph appears in Mallory Hope Ferrell's book Slow Trains Down South on page 199.
